Sarcopenia as a Determinant of Chemotherapy Toxicity and Time to Tumor Progression in Metastatic Breast Cancer Patients Receiving Capecitabine Treatment

Clinical Cancer Research · 2009 · Vol. 15(8) · pp. 2920–2926
Carla M. PradoVickie E. BaracosLinda J. McCargarTony ReimanMarina MourtzakisKatia TonkinJohn R. MackeySheryl KoskiEdith PituskinMichael B. Sawyer

Abstract

Sarcopenia is a significant predictor of toxicity and TTP in metastatic breast cancer patients treated with capecitabine. Our results raise the potential use of body composition assessment to predict toxicity and individualize chemotherapy dosing.
